Introduction: Why Anthropology is One of the Most Scoring Optionals in UPSC
Anthropology has consistently remained one of the most reliable and high-scoring optional subjects in the UPSC Civil Services Examination. Every year, a large number of top rankers choose Anthropology because of its concise syllabus, scientific structure, predictable questions and strong overlap with General Studies.
However, it is important to understand that high marks in Anthropology do not come from reading alone. They come from writing, revising and refining answers under proper mentorship.
Many aspirants complete books, watch lectures and make notes, but still fail to cross the 250–260 mark in Mains because:
- Their answers lack structure
- Concepts are not applied to questions
- Diagrams and examples are missing
- Time management is weak
- PYQ-based approach is not followed
